@steelbreeze/broker
Version:
Lightweight publish and subscribe using Server-Sent Events for node and express
9 lines (8 loc) • 419 B
TypeScript
import { Router } from 'express';
/**
* Creates an instance of a message broker server.
* Many message broker servers may be created, each bound to a different base url.
* @param cacheLastMessage When true, subscribers will receive the last message upon subscrition.
* @returns Returns an express Router for use within an express application.
*/
export declare function server(cacheLastMessage?: boolean): Router;